MG MGF Technical - clunking noise

hi,,, i have a mgf vvc 2000 and a small probmlem has came up (hoping to be small) when i pull off in first gear off a curb and land on the road there is a clunking noise coming from the wheels i dont know if its the shocks... any help guys??????

If you're going up & down kerbs a lot, check the drop links between the anti-roll bar and hub assemblies, they get more brittle with age so can break fairly easily.

I can't help with your clonking noise, but driving up and down kerbs can also break the reinforcing cords in tyre sidewalls, especially at the front.

The damage is not visible so the first you know about it is likely to be when you suffer a blow-out. This is not a nice experience at the best of times so best avoided.
